Ste. Michelle Wine Estates, an icon of the Pacific Northwest, was the first premium wine company in Washington state, with roots dating back to 1933. For more than 90 years, we have set the standard for excellence, earning recognition as one of the most acclaimed premium wine companies in the United States. Today our wines are enjoyed in all 50 states in 100 countries.
Our award-winning portfolio reflects an unwavering commitment to quality and sustainability, showcasing the distinctive character of Washington and Oregon’s renowned growing regions. Ste. Michelle Wine Estates’ brands include Chateau Ste. Michelle, 14 Hands, Columbia Crest, Liquid Light, ESTIVAL, ETHOS, Spring Valley Vineyard, and Northstar from Washington State. Ste. Michelle also serves as the sales agent for A to Z Wineworks, Erath, and REX HILL from Oregon.
